Evaluweb, Inc. formed to create inter-brand comparison site

Site will focus on security products and services

ARLINGTON, VA. April 19, 2005  - Evaluweb, Inc. has announced its incorporation in the State of Virginia.   Security Industry veteran John Szczygiel who most recently was President of the Siemens Security Division in North America founded Evaluweb.

Mr. Szczygiel has been in the electronic security industry for twenty-one years and previous held senior management positions with Siemens Building Technologies, Security Technologies Group and Sensormatic.  

Evaluweb's mission is to facilitate a more efficient marketplace through organization of security product data and simplification of the buying process. "We want to save buyers and sellers time and money by providing a quick means to properly match buyer requirements with seller capabilities" said John Szczygiel.

Evaluweb will create a unique website for the security industry which provides users the power to find and compare security products and services.  The site will feature the EvalumatchSM engine, which translates a users business needs and buying criteria into well-matched solutions.

Evaluweb expects the site to go live in early December of 2005.
